Subject: Re: [PATCH] drm/tests: mm: Convert to drm_dbg_printer
Date: Fri, 09 Feb 2024 17:06:53 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<87o7cpad82.fsf@intel.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20240209140818.106685-1-michal.winiarski@intel.com>

On Fri, 09 Feb 2024, Michał Winiarski <michal.winiarski@intel.com> wrote:
> Fix one of the tests in drm_mm that was not converted prior to
> drm_debug_printer removal, causing tests build failure.

My bad, thanks for fixing this.

Reviewed-by: Jani Nikula <jani.nikula@intel.com>

For one thing, I must not have git grep'd for new drm_debug_printer()
additions since I wrote the patch.

For another, I'm missing some kernel config, because I built the changes
on x86, arm and arm64 before pushing. In particular the arm and arm64
configs I just recently added from drm-rerere repo. Those defconfigs
should probably be updated. They don't have CONFIG_DRM_XE=m either.

> Fixes: e154c4fc7bf2d ("drm: remove drm_debug_printer in favor of drm_dbg_printer")
> Signed-off-by: Michał Winiarski <michal.winiarski@intel.com>
> ---
>  drivers/gpu/drm/tests/drm_mm_test.c | 2 +-
>  1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)
>
> di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/tests/drm_mm_test.c b/drivers/gpu/drm/tests/drm_mm_test.c
> index 1eb0c304f9607..3488d930e3a38 100644
> --- a/drivers/gpu/drm/tests/drm_mm_test.c
> +++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/tests/drm_mm_test.c
> @@ -188,7 +188,7 @@ static void drm_test_mm_init(struct kunit *test)
>  
>  static void drm_test_mm_debug(struct kunit *test)
>  {
> -	struct drm_printer p = drm_debug_printer(test->name);
> +	struct drm_printer p = drm_dbg_printer(NULL, DRM_UT_CORE, test->name);
>  	struct drm_mm mm;
>  	struct drm_mm_node nodes[2];
